Ò׽ؽØÍ¼Èí¼þ¡¢µ¥Îļþ¡¢Ãâ°²×°¡¢´¿ÂÌÉ«¡¢½ö160KB

Chapter 04 _Array(core JavaÕªÒª)

Ò»¡¢Êý×éÊÇʲô£¿
1.»ù±¾¸ÅÄ
Definition£ºÊý×é¾ÍÊÇÏàͬÀàÐÍÔªËØµÄÏßÐÔ¼¯ºÏ¡£
Array is a collection of the same data.
An array is object.
¶ÔÊý×éµÄÀí½â£º
Êý×éÊÇÒ»¸ö¶ÔÏó£¬ÊÇÒ»¸öÖ¸ÏòÊý×éµÄÒýÓöÔÏó¡£
2.Syntax
Array Copy
¶þ¡¢ÎªÊ²Ã´ÒªÊ¹ÓÃÊý×飿
Èý¡¢Êý×éÖ÷ÒªÓÃÔÚÄÄЩµØ·½£¿Êý×é²»ÄÜÓÃÔÚÄÄЩµØ·½£¿
ËÄ¡¢ÔõôÑùʹÓÃÊý×飿ÈçºÎ¸üºÃµØÊ¹ÓÃÊý×飿Ӧ¸ÃÑ¡ÔñÔõÑùµÄÊý×飨Array£¬ArrayList£¬LinkedList£¬Vector£©
1.Êý×éµÄʹÓãº
 A£®declare
int [] a=new int[3](ÉùÃ÷Ò»¸öÊý×éÀàÐ͵ijÉÔ±±äÁ¿£¬²¢´´½¨Ò»¸öÊý×é)
int[] a={};
int a[]={};
int a[][]={}
 B£®create
Sample£ºa=new int[3];
        int[] a={1,2,3};
Advanced Feature:
a£®ÔÚ¶ÑÖзÖÅäÁ¬ÐøÄÚ´æ¿Õ¼ä£»
b£®¶ÔÊý×éÔªËØ¸³È±Ê¡Öµ£»
c£®ÔÚÕ»Öдæ·ÅaÒýÓÃÀàÐͱäÁ¿£¬²¢Ö¸Ïò¶ÑÖеÄÊý×é
Tips£ºÊý×é´´½¨µÄ¹ý³Ì
´´½¨³¤¶ÈΪ2µÄÊý×飬¶ÑÖзÖÅä¿Õ¼ä£¬¸øÊý×éÔªËØ¸³Ä¬ÈÏÖµ¡£
     C£®initialize£¨³õʼ»¯£©
     Example£ºa[0]=1£»
2£®¶àάÊý×飺
¹æÔòµÄ¶þάÊý×é
²»¹æÔòµÄ¶þάÊý×é
(1) declare
  Example: int[][] a1;
          int[]a2 [];
          int a3 [][];
(2)create
  Example£ºa1=new int[2][];
           a1[0]=new int[3];
         a1[1]=new int[2];
         a1[2]=new int[1];
(3) initialize:
   for (int i=0;i<a1.lengh;i++){
      for(int j=0;j<a1[i].length;j++){
         a1[i][j]=default value;
      }
   }
Advanced Features
(1) Êý×éϱ겻ҪԽ½ç£¨·ñÔòJVM throws Run


Ïà¹ØÎĵµ£º

javaÖÐÈçºÎʹÓÃamcharts


×î½ü¹«Ë¾Åöµ½ÐèÒªÓÃͼ±íµÄÐÎʽÏÔʾһЩÊý¾Ý£¬ÎҾͿªÊ¼µ½ÍøÉϲéѯ£¬²éµ½ÁËjfreechartºÍamcharts,ÕâÁ½ÕßÎÒ¶¼ÊµÏÖ¹ýÁË£¬jfreechart×îºóÉú³ÉͼƬ£¬µ«ÊÇͼƬЧ¹û²»ÊÇÎÒÏëÒªµÄ£¬È»ºóÓÖÑо¿amcharts ËüµÄЧ¹ûȷʵºÜºÃ£¬¶øÇÒ¹Ù·½ÍøÕ¾ÉÏ»¹ÓкÃЩÀý×ӿɹ©ÏÂÔØ£¬ÍøÖ·ÊÇ:www.amcharts.com
£¨ÏëÒªÍê³ÉÒ»¸öamchartsͼÐÎÐèÒªswfobjects. ......

ÎöJAVAÖ®À¬»ø»ØÊÕ»úÖÆ

¶ÔÓÚJAVA±à³ÌºÍºÜ¶àÀàËÆC¡¢C++ÓïÑÔÓÐÒ»¸ö¾Þ´óÇø±ð¾ÍÊÇÄÚ´æ²»ÐèÒª×Ô¼ºÈ¥free»òÕßdelete£¬¶øÊÇÓÉJVMÀ¬»ø»ØÊÕ»úÖÆÈ¥Íê³ÉµÄ¡£¶ÔÓÚÕâ¸ö¹ý³ÌºÜ¶àÈËÒ»Ö±±È½ÏãȻ»òÕß¾õµÃºÜÖÇÄÜ£¬Ê¹µÃÔÚд³ÌÐòµÄ¹ý³Ì²»Ì«¿¼ÂÇËüµÄ¸ÐÊÜ£¬Æäʵ֪µÀһЩÄÚÔÚµÄÔ­Àí£¬°ïÖúÎÒÃDZàд¸ü¼ÓÓÅÐãµÄ´úÂëÊǷdz£ÓбØÒªµÄ¡£
 
±¾ÎÄ´ÓÒÔϼ¸¸ö·½Ãæ½øÐвûÊö£º ......

JAVAºÍJAVAC ÃüÁîÐÐ

javacºÍjavaÃüÁîÐÐÖеÄ-classpathÑ¡Ïî
ÕâÊǸöºÜ»ù´¡µÄÎÊÌ⣬µ«ÊÇÒòΪ»ù±¾É϶¼ÊÇÓÃÏÖÓеÄIDE¹¤¾ß À´¿ª·¢java³ÌÐò£¬ËùÒÔºÜÉÙÓÐÈËÒâʶµ½ÕâÒ»µã¡£
javac
-classpath£¬É趨ҪËÑË÷ÀàµÄ·¾¶£¬¿ÉÒÔÊÇĿ¼£¬jarÎļþ£¬zipÎļþ£¨ÀïÃæ¶¼ÊÇclassÎļþ£©£¬»á¸²¸ÇµôËùÓÐÔÚCLASSPATHÀïÃæµÄÉ趨¡£
-sourcepath£¬ É趨ҪËÑË÷±àÒëËùÐèjava Î ......

Chapter 01 _Getting Started(core JavaÕªÒª)

Ò»¡¢ºËÐĸÅÄî
1.ʲô½ÐÀࣿ
Àà¾ÍÊÇijһÖÖÊÂÎïµÄÒ»°ãÐԵļ¯ºÏÌ壬ÊÇÏàͬ»òÏàËÆµÄ¸÷¸öÊÂÎï¹²Í¬ÌØÐÔµÄÒ»ÖÖ³éÏó¡£
2.ʲô½Ð¶ÔÏó£¿
ÔÚÃæÏò¶ÔÏó¸ÅÄîÖУ¬¶ÔÏó£¨Object£©ÊÇÀàµÄʵÀý£¨instance£©¡£¶ÔÏóÓëÀàµÄ¹ØÏµ¾ÍÏñ±äÁ¿ÓëÊý¾ÝÀàÐ͵ĹØÏµÒ»Ñù¡£
3.ÀàµÄºËÐÄÌØÐÔÓÐÄÄЩ£¿
Àà¾ßÓзâ×°ÐÔ¡¢¼Ì³ÐÐԺͶà̬ÐÔ¡£
·â×°ÐÔ£º
ÀàµÄ·â×°ÐÔ ......
© 2009 ej38.com All Rights Reserved. ¹ØÓÚE½¡ÍøÁªÏµÎÒÃÇ | Õ¾µãµØÍ¼ | ¸ÓICP±¸09004571ºÅ